Oppo is preparing to unveil its new Find X9s Pro in China on April 21, alongside the Find X9 Ultra. While the Ultra model is expected to reach global markets, the X9s Pro may initially remain China-exclusive.

Ahead of the launch, fresh leaked renders shared by tipster Evan Blass have revealed key design details and colour choices of the upcoming device. The handset is seen in cyan, orange, titanium, and white shades, aligning with earlier reports suggesting multiple vibrant finish options including green variants.

Design-wise, the phone continues Oppo’s X9 series styling but is believed to be the most compact model in the lineup, featuring a 6.32-inch display. The rear houses a square camera island with rounded edges, carrying a triple-camera setup arranged in a distinctive triangular layout, including a periscope lens.

On the front, the device appears to feature ultra-slim symmetrical bezels with a centred punch-hole camera. Physical buttons are placed on the right side frame for volume and power control.

Earlier benchmarking listings suggest the device may be powered by the MediaTek Dimensity 9500 chipset, paired with up to 16GB RAM and Android 16-based ColorOS 16.

Camera specifications are expected to include a 200MP primary sensor, a 200MP periscope telephoto lens, and a 50MP ultrawide shooter under a Hasselblad partnership.

The smartphone may also pack a 7,025mAh battery with 80W wired and 50W wireless charging support. Additional expected features include an ultrasonic fingerprint sensor, IP68/IP69 durability ratings, and a premium metal build.
